Police department calls: Speeding driver arrested by Keizer police for DUII

Police Scanner – January 18 – January 25

A Keizer man stopped for speeding on Northeast Cherry Avenue on Saturday, Jan. 24, gave police a false name before he was arrested, Keizer police reported.

Sone Yamamoto was stopped near Martin Luther King Jr. Parkway at about 5:30 a.m.

He was arrested for DUII, reckless driving and giving false information to police.

In other police activity:

•Officers responded to a report at about 8 a.m. Friday, Jan. 16, that a man had assaulted a customer at VP Racing Fuels, 4495 River Rd. N. The victim left before police arrived and couldn’t be identified.

Officers arrested Timothy R. Gilbert Jr. 28, of Keizer for criminal trespass and theft for taking a pair of sunglasses from the convenience store.

•On Tuesday, Jan. 20, Salem police contacted Keizer police about a vehicle found on Northeast Front Street that hadn’t been moved in several days and was reported stolen. The vehicle had been stolen on Jan. 11 when it was left running to warm up at a home on North Glynbrook Street in Keizer. Police said the vehicle appeared undamaged.
